Understanding Energy Funding Requirements
The energy sector encompasses a broad spectrum of activities related to the production, consumption, and management of energy across various platformsranging from renewable sources like solar and wind to traditional fossil fuels. This overview targets individuals and organizations interested in participating in funding initiatives related to energy and helps define the scope, use cases, and eligibility criteria associated with such grants.
Defining Scope and Use Cases
When discussing energy-related grants, applicants should clarify specific areas of focus to understand their eligibility better. The spectrum of funding applications can include, but is not limited to, projects aimed at improving energy efficiency, the installation of renewable energy systems, or the exploration of innovative technologies that reduce carbon footprints. A commonly referenced regulation in this setting is the Energy Policy Act, which sets forth guidelines and incentives for promoting various energy projects.
Concrete use cases for potential applicants include:
- Solar Installation Grants: These funds may be allocated for residential or commercial solar array installations, aimed at reducing dependence on grid electricity, leading to cost savings and environmental benefits.
- Energy Efficiency Upgrades: Funding could support retrofitting buildings to improve insulation, install high-efficiency appliances, or adopt more efficient heating and cooling systems.
- Research and Development Initiatives: Grants may also facilitate advanced research in energy technologies, such as smart grids or new biofuel sources, targeting innovative solutions to contemporary energy challenges.
While there are substantial opportunities for funding, certain projects may be less suitable due to misalignments with grant purposes. For instance, ventures not primarily focused on improving energy infrastructure or those lacking clear, measurable outcomes may not qualify.

Measurement and Reporting Requirements
Once funding is acquired and projects are underway, applicants must adhere to specific measurement and reporting obligations that ensure accountability and transparency. Required outcomes generally focus on quantifiable improvements in energy efficiency or the amount of renewable energy generated or saved. Key performance indicators (KPIs) often include:
- Reduction in energy costs: Evaluating how funding translates into operational savings for the recipient.
- Energy savings metrics: Quantifying the decrease in energy consumption resulting from project implementation, measured before and after project execution.
- Emission reductions: Documenting decreases in greenhouse gas emissions linked to project initiatives, a critical metric for assessing the environmental impact of energy-related grants.
Grants may also require regular progress reports, detailing advancements made and financial expenditures, ensuring projects remain on track and within budgetary constraints. Being thorough in reporting can enhance an applicant's credibility and improve chances of obtaining future funding.
